三国杀网页版:如何在浏览器中随时随地体验经典策略对决?
【免费下载链接】noname项目地址: https://gitcode.com/GitHub_Trending/no/noname
还在为找不到合适的桌游伙伴而烦恼?或者想重温三国杀的经典对决却受限于时间和空间?开源三国杀网页版为你提供了完美的解决方案——一款完全基于浏览器运行的三国杀游戏,无需下载安装,打开即玩,让你在任何设备上都能享受原汁原味的三国策略体验。
🎯 核心特性矩阵:为什么选择网页版三国杀?
| 特性维度 | 传统桌游 | 客户端游戏 | 网页版三国杀 |
|---|---|---|---|
| 部署复杂度 | 需要实体卡牌和场地 | 需要下载安装客户端 | 一键启动,零安装 |
| 跨平台支持 | 仅限实体环境 | 特定操作系统 | 全平台浏览器支持 |
| 资源占用 | 物理空间需求大 | 磁盘空间占用 | 云端运行,本地轻量 |
| 更新维护 | 需购买新扩展包 | 需手动更新版本 | 在线实时更新 |
| 社交便利性 | 需面对面聚会 | 需相同客户端 | 链接分享,随时开局 |
图:桃园结义场景背景图 - 网页版三国杀精美古风背景
🚀 环境准备:开启你的三国之旅需要什么?
系统要求:任何支持现代浏览器的设备(Chrome 85+内核、Firefox、Safari等)网络环境:建议稳定网络连接,支持离线缓存功能存储空间:浏览器缓存约100-200MB,自动管理无需手动清理
获取项目源码
# 克隆项目到本地 git clone https://gitcode.com/GitHub_Trending/no/noname cd noname代码注释:通过Git获取最新版三国杀网页版源码,包含所有游戏资源和逻辑
启动本地服务器
# 使用Python内置服务器(推荐) python -m http.server 8000 # 或者使用Node.js(如果已安装) npx serve .代码注释:选择适合你环境的Web服务器,端口号可自定义(如8080、3000等)
验证运行状态
打开浏览器访问http://localhost:8000,看到游戏加载界面即表示部署成功。首次加载可能需要1-2分钟缓存资源,后续访问将秒速启动。
🎮 核心功能深度解析:不仅仅是卡牌游戏
经典身份场模式:策略与心理的博弈
想象一下,你作为主公需要辨别忠臣与反贼,或者作为内奸需要在暗处谋划最终胜利。网页版三国杀完美还原了这一经典玩法,所有角色配置都在 character/ 目录中管理,支持超过200名武将的丰富选择。
技术实现简析:游戏采用模块化设计,每个武将都是一个独立的配置对象,包含性别、势力、体力、技能等属性。例如曹操的配置:
caocao: ["male", "wei", 4, ["jianxiong", "hujia"], ["zhu"]]代码注释:这行配置定义了曹操的性别、势力、体力值、技能列表和特殊标签
多元游戏模式:满足不同玩家需求
除了经典身份场,网页版还支持:
- 国战模式:双将组合,千变万化的技能搭配
- 1v1对决:快速对战,考验单挑技巧
- 斗地主模式:三人混战的全新体验
- 单机挑战:与AI对战,磨练技术
所有游戏模式都在 mode/ 目录中定义,采用事件驱动架构确保游戏逻辑的清晰分离。
图:赤壁之战海战背景 - 网页版三国杀史诗级战斗场景
视觉与听觉的沉浸式体验
游戏拥有完整的视觉和音频系统:
- 精美角色立绘:超过2000张高质量角色图片
- 动态场景背景:根据游戏模式自动切换
- 完整音效系统:角色语音、技能音效、背景音乐
- 多主题支持:木质、简约、音乐等多种界面主题
所有资源文件按类型组织:
- 角色图片:
image/character/ - 背景图片:
image/background/ - 音频文件:
audio/background/、audio/skill/、audio/voice/
扩展开发:打造你的专属三国杀
网页版三国杀支持高度自定义:
// 添加自定义武将示例 const customCharacter = { "my_hero": ["male", "qun", 4, ["custom_skill1", "custom_skill2"], []] };代码注释:通过简单的配置即可创建全新武将,技能逻辑在skill目录中定义
自定义卡牌:在 card/ 目录中添加新的卡牌配置设计专属模式:参考现有模式文件创建全新玩法界面主题定制:修改 theme/ 目录中的CSS文件
🔧 最佳实践建议:提升游戏体验的实用技巧
性能优化策略
缓存利用技巧:
- 首次访问后,游戏资源会自动缓存到浏览器本地存储
- 建议在稳定的网络环境下完成首次加载
- 定期清理浏览器缓存可能导致重新下载资源
移动端适配:
/* 移动端优化示例 */ @media (max-width: 768px) { .card { transform: scale(0.8); } .character-info { font-size: 14px; } }代码注释:游戏已内置响应式设计,自动适配不同屏幕尺寸
游戏设置优化
在game/config.js中可以调整多项游戏参数:
- 音频设置:背景音乐音量、音效音量
- 界面选项:卡牌样式、角色显示方式
- 游戏规则:禁将列表、特殊规则开关
扩展管理建议
网页版支持在线扩展加载,但需要注意:
- 只从可信源下载扩展包
- 定期检查扩展兼容性
- 备份自定义配置到本地
🎨 视觉定制:打造个性化游戏界面
游戏提供了丰富的视觉定制选项,所有主题文件位于 theme/ 目录:
主题切换:木质、简约、音乐等多种预设主题背景自定义:支持上传个人图片作为游戏背景字体选择:小篆、黄草、行书等多种古风字体
图:现代动漫风格背景 - 网页版三国杀支持多种视觉风格
🤝 社区参与:成为开源项目的一份子
如何贡献代码?
网页版三国杀采用模块化架构,便于开发者参与:
- 修复BUG:在GitHub Issues中查找并修复问题
- 添加功能:遵循现有代码风格扩展新功能
- 翻译完善:帮助完善多语言支持
- 文档改进:补充使用说明和开发文档
制作扩展包
想要分享自己设计的武将或卡牌?
- 创建独立的扩展包目录
- 遵循项目结构规范
- 提交Pull Request到主仓库
常见问题解答:Q:游戏支持离线游玩吗?A:完全支持!首次加载后,游戏资源会缓存在浏览器中,即使断网也能正常游戏。
Q:如何保存游戏进度?A:游戏使用浏览器本地存储自动保存设置和进度,刷新页面不会丢失数据。
Q:可以在手机上玩吗?A:完美支持!游戏采用响应式设计,在手机和平板上都能获得良好体验。
🚀 立即行动:开启你的三国杀之旅
现在你已经了解了网页版三国杀的所有优势——无需安装、跨平台支持、丰富功能、高度可定制。无论你是想重温经典的三国杀对决,还是想体验创新的游戏模式,这个开源项目都能满足你的需求。
价值重申:
- 🎯零门槛体验:打开浏览器即可开始游戏
- 🎨视觉盛宴:精美的美术资源和音效系统
- 🔧高度可扩展:支持自定义武将、卡牌和模式
- 🤝开源社区:活跃的开发者社区持续改进
不要再等待了!立即克隆项目,启动服务器,在浏览器中体验最纯粹的三国策略对决。无论是与朋友在线对战,还是独自挑战AI,网页版三国杀都能为你带来无尽的乐趣。
图:云无月角色立绘 - 网页版三国杀精美角色设计
开始你的三国征程:
- 克隆项目到本地
- 启动Web服务器
- 打开浏览器访问
- 选择你喜欢的游戏模式
- 享受策略对决的乐趣!
记住,开源的力量在于共享与协作。如果你有好的想法或改进建议,欢迎加入社区,一起让这个项目变得更好。三国杀的战场已经为你开启,现在就加入吧!
【免费下载链接】noname项目地址: https://gitcode.com/GitHub_Trending/no/noname
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考